Helpful Plumbing Tools to Keep at Home
House owners require to be outfitted for plumbing emergencies in case of sudden problems with their plumbing components. It is for that reason needed to have some standard plumbing devices. Using the finest plumbing devices will offer you the called for outcomes as well as of course, makes simple DIY plumbing repair work feasible.

Auger:


This is likewise referred to as a drain serpent and is used for getting rid of drainpipe obstructions. This tool is placed into obstructed drains to pull out clogs and also gunk from the drainpipe. You placed it in the drain and also spin it to break clogs right into tinier little bits for easy cleaning.

A container wrench:


This is an additional device that ought to be in every residence. When doing plumbing fixings, it may be required to loosen up bolts and also sink plumbing components.

Pliers:


The kind of pliers recommended for plumbing is the tongue-and-groove pliers. Pliers are really valuable devices for Do it yourself plumbers.

Teflon tape:


This is additionally typically called plumber's tape. It is made use of to snugly secure heap joints and also suitable. The tapes are in rolls reduced to certain sizes as well as sizes. It is an impenetrable seal and as a result of this, it can be utilized to hold off leakages till professional assistance arrives.

Plunger:


Plunger is a great device for fixing plumbing concerns. It is made use of to clear clogs in toilets, kitchen sinks, as well as other drains in your home. There are different kinds of plungers for managing various kinds of drainpipe blockages so you ought to have different types and dimensions of bettor relying on the one that fits your drains. There are two main sorts of bettor: the cup and also the flange. Each of these has its certain applications for cleaning up drain obstructions.

Basic Plumbing Tools You Should Have on Hand


Pliers


There are many different pliers out there, so as long as you have a pair on hand, they’ll help you in a plumbing pinch. However, water pump pliers or needle-nose pliers are especially helpful.



Water pump pliers allow for a solid grip on nuts and bolts, irregular-shaped objects, and even smooth pipes. Needle-nose pliers are perfect for reaching into cramped and tiny spaces. They can also be especially helpful with clearing clumps of hair or dirt out of the shower drain.


Adjustable Wrench



Another must-have for any tool kit. This tool is multi-functional and can help with a variety of plumbing repair and maintenance fixes. Having an adjustable wrench makes it perfect for tightening and loosening different kinds of nuts and bolts easily.



These wrenches can help you unscrew or fasten plumbing fixtures like pipes, elbows, and faucets. Just make sure the jaw is on the side you’ll be rotating and that it’s secured snug around the pipe or fixture to avoid breaking your tool.


Auger/Snake


Two different tools, but we felt they should be in the same section. A plumbing auger is commonly used for toilet clogs, while a drain snake helps tackle clogs in bathtubs, sinks, or showers.



If you have one bathroom in your living situation, you’ll definitely need to get one of these. Plungers are great and can help get things unclogged easily, but if it happens to not work, you don’t want to be without a toilet for too long.


Duct Tape


Not one of the common plumbing tools, but still very useful in case of a plumbing emergency. Duct tape can fix small plumbing leaks before they grow too big. When you use the duct tape, it’ll create an airtight, waterproof band-aid for any small repairs.



Of course, this isn’t a permanent solution but can work in a pinch if a plumber can’t make it out to you soon.
